BKE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2019 in Review

178 of the 4,621 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Buckle (BKE) for Q1 2019, worth a combined $618M — up 0.12% from $617M a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 30 funds closed out of BKE and 23 opened new positions — a net loss of 7 holders — while 53 trimmed existing stakes and 64 added.

The largest buyer was Mirae Asset Global Investments, opening a new position worth an estimated $9.01M. The largest seller was American Century Companies, exiting entirely with an estimated $5.14M sold.
